Vacuum Forming for Customized Packaging
Vacuum forming is a manufacturing technique that uses heated thermoplastic sheets to create shaped packaging components.
During the process, the sheet is heated until it becomes flexible and then positioned over a mould. Vacuum pressure draws the material against the mould, allowing it to take the required shape. Once the material cools, the formed sheet is trimmed and finished.
The process offers flexibility in creating different cavity depths, profiles, dimensions, and packaging configurations.
Custom Trays for Organized Component Handling
Vacuum formed trays can be developed to hold multiple products in an organized arrangement. Each cavity can correspond to a specific component, helping workers quickly identify where products should be placed.
Depending on the application, trays can include:
• Single or multiple product cavities
• Different cavity depths
• Component separators
• Raised support sections
• Side walls
• Finger-access areas
• Stacking features
• Customized dimensions
Such features can help make repetitive packing and handling processes more systematic.

Benefits for Internal Logistics
Packaging does not only protect products during external transportation. It can also play an important role inside a manufacturing facility.
Standardized trays can be used to transfer components from one workstation to another. A predetermined number of parts can be placed in each tray, making it easier to monitor quantities and organize production materials.
This can help establish a consistent material-handling process across different stages of manufacturing.
